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
984 5937133 32463529 3178534 68290525
688000 7038 9570393616
688000 7038 9570393616
4680089230 55 66
All about undefined
Interested in learning more?
688000 7038 9570393616
4680089230 55 66
See more
14069 770567856 80737420
9699 612711 4492802126
See more
169944 64457869254 335430
56 90390 78208 03750 157
See more